Eligible homeowners wanting to switch to solar can make the most of LookSee’s Solar Loan to fund their transition to renewable energy. Homeowners have another chance to plug into the sun as LookSee’s low-interest rate Solar Loan gets extended by six months. Later-stage solar flares could be more disruptive to communication systems than previously thought, according to new research. While it’s well known the first wave of a solar flare – a sudden burst of energy from the Sun – can knock out GPS signals and trigger global radio blackouts, the secondary emission is less-studied.
